Band 7- Speech and Language Therapists- London
Job Title: Locum Speech and Language Therapists Banding : Band 7 Start date: ASAP Duration: Until 31:05:2025 Location : L ondon Working Hours : Monday – Friday, 8am- 4pm Rate : £29-£34
We are seeking highly skilled and motivated Speech and Language Therapists to join our team in London.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work within a tertiary setting, providing specialist assessment, treatment, and management of language, communication, and swallowing problems in adult clients.
Responsibilities:
As a Speech and Language Therapist, you will demonstrate highly specialist clinical expertise in the assessment, treatment, and management of language, communication, and swallowing problems in adult clients. You will provide evidence-based specialist intervention and evaluate outcomes, maintaining associated records as an autonomous practitioner. Your role will involve demonstrating highly specialist knowledge underpinned by current evidence-based practice and outcome measures. Additionally, you will utilize highly specialist clinical skills for interpretative assessment techniques and interventions in the care of patients with tracheostomies and those requiring instrumental procedures such as video fluoroscopy.
Qualifications and Experience:
- Degree in Speech and Language Therapy
- HCPC registration
- Experience in neurology and progressive neurological conditions
- Training in FEES (Fiberoptic Endoscopic Evaluation of Swallowing) and video fluoroscopy highly beneficial
- Highly specialist knowledge in neurorehabilitation
- Ability to work independently and as part of a multidisciplinary team
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
